Hustle conflict with Give - Constant Contact Form

I'm getting this error upon trying to activate Hustle Pro.

Fatal error: require(): Failed opening required '.../wp-content/plugins/give-constant-contact/constant-contact-sdk/src/Ctct/CTCTOfficialSplClassLoader.php' in .../wp-content/plugins/give-constant-contact/constant-contact-sdk/src/Ctct/SplClassLoader.php on line 137

During the chat I found out that it's a conflict with the Give - Constant Contact plugin, which is an add-on for the Give - Donation Plugin. But when only Give - Donation Plugin is active, Hustle Pro works fine.

  • Katya Tsihotska

    Hi Tim

    Hope you're having a great day!

    This issue has been flagged for our SLS Team (code experts) so that they can dig into this issue further for you. An update will be posted here as soon as more information is available. Thank you for your patience while we sort through this issue.

    Also, I would recommend you to contact the Give - Constant Contact plugin developers or support team, in case if the issue is on their side because the Fatal Error that is causing issues related to the Give - Constant Contact plugin.

    The error itself means that the Give - Constant Contact plugin tries to load file which doesn't exist (/wp-content/plugins/give-constant-contact/constant-contact-sdk/src/Ctct/CTCTOfficialSplClassLoader.php), I suppose that this file has been lost during the installation or after it so I'd suggest you to try to re-install this pluign. Please, make sure you have a backup of the site before doing any changes.

    Kind regards,
    Katya

  • Tim

    message from give support:

    Thank you for sending that over. With those credentials, I made a test copy of your site into a local development environment.

    I found that there is, in fact, a plugin conflict between Hustle and the current versions of Give Constant Contact.

    There has been some recent development for Give Constant Contact, so I decided to see if the issue remained in the latest version that is to be released soon.

    The issue is solved as of the latest slated release. I installed and activated both plugins without issue.

    Currently, this addon is still in active development, so I am unable to provide a timeline for release.

    I have marked your ticket, and will keep you updated with any progress that I see moving forward.

    Please let me know if there is anything else I can assist you with in the meantime.

    Thank you for your patience, and have a great rest of your day.

    `

Thank NAME, for their help.

Let NAME know exactly why they deserved these points.

Gift a custom amount of points.